Currently the msdosfs partition on RPI-B SD card images is 17MB, and is 74%
full.  It's enough to boot, but a bit too small when you want to experiment
with different firmware ('bootloader') releases, and there's no easy way ar=
ound
it, apart from recompiling the image myself.

Raspbian uses 41MB partition on their release images:

=3D>     63  9666497  md0  MBR  (4.6G)
       63     8129       - free -  (4.0M)
     8192    85611    1  !12  (42M)
    93803     4501       - free -  (2.2M)
    98304  9568256    2  linux-data  (4.6G)

I propose to increase our size to the same value.  (FIWIW, theirs is 51% fu=
ll,
they use 21MB of it).
